Abnormal Shiba Inu (SHIB) Whale Activity Ends Up with 73% Crash

Main Idea
Abnormal whale activity in Shiba Inu (SHIB) led to a 73% crash in a key metric, with large inflows of tokens failing to sustain a price rally.
Key Points
1. On August 1, wallets holding over 0.1% of SHIB's supply received more than 750 billion tokens in a single transaction.
2. By August 4, inflows dropped to 425.54 billion SHIB, and the price fell to $0.000013, marking a downturn.
3. Within days, inflows further declined to just over 115 billion tokens, and SHIB's price dropped around 73% from its early-month peak.
4. The token is currently trying to hold support at $0.0000129, with a stronger floor at $0.00001107.
5. The abnormal whale activity did not result in a sustained price rally, contrary to initial optimism.
